Subject: Re: [net-next,PATCH 1/2] dt-bindings: net: add STM32MP25 compatible in documentation for stm32

On 6/14/24 3:08 PM, Christophe Roullier wrote:
> New STM32 SOC have 2 GMACs instances.
> GMAC IP version is SNPS 5.30
>
> Signed-off-by: Christophe Roullier <christophe.roullier@foss.st.com>
> ---
> Documentation/devicetree/bindings/net/stm32-dwmac.yaml | 6 ++++++
> 1 file changed, 6 insertions(+)
>
> diff --git a/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/net/stm32-dwmac.yaml b/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/net/stm32-dwmac.yaml
> index f6e5e0626a3f..d087d8eaea12 100644
> --- a/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/net/stm32-dwmac.yaml
> +++ b/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/net/stm32-dwmac.yaml
> @@ -23,12 +23,17 @@ select:
> - st,stm32-dwmac
> - st,stm32mp1-dwmac
> - st,stm32mp13-dwmac
> + - st,stm32mp25-dwmac
> required:
> - compatible
>
> properties:
> compatible:
> oneOf:
> + - items:
> + - enum:
> + - st,stm32mp25-dwmac
> + - const: snps,dwmac-5.20
> - items:
> - enum:
> - st,stm32mp1-dwmac
> @@ -121,6 +126,7 @@ allOf:
> compatible:
> contains:
> enum:
> + - st,stm32mp25-dwmac
> - st,stm32mp1-dwmac
> - st,stm32-dwmac
Keep the list sorted please.
